**DRIFT-2214: Occupancy feed config drift — Harrow Street garage**

The Stallwatch occupancy feed for the Harrow Street garage diverged from the committed baseline sometime after the March reader swap. Symptoms: stale counts after midnight resets and a debounce window roughly double what the repo specifies. Root cause was a manual hotfix applied on the box and never backported. Do not re-apply manual edits; fix in the Tinwheel repo and redeploy. For reconciliation, the live configuration pulled from the node is as follows:

deployment values, kajep-kageg:
[praix]
host = praix.paliqcorp.corp
user = praix_svc
database = praix_prod

## Account Recovery — Trailnote Offline Mode

When a surveyor's Trailnote app has been offline for 30+ days, their local credentials expire and sync refuses to resume. Don't make them wipe the device — all their unsynced field data lives there! Instead, open the support console, pick "Offline Reinstate," and enter their handle. The console will ask for the support team's shared recovery passphrase before issuing a reinstatement token. Use the one below.

unlock words, bagaf-fajeg: zorael-kelax-fraath-quenix-eliok-sileth-aldmir-wenir-druiel

## Service Accounts — StormFan Alert Fan-Out

The fan-out worker authenticates to the internal dispatch tier using the svc-stormfan account. Rotate quarterly; scopes are limited to publish-only on alert topics. If deliveries stall during your shift, verify the worker is using the current credential, reproduced below for reference.

API key for kaweg-hahif: kto4_rAjZ

Night-shift support at Varnholt Tower: no visitors after 22:00, no exceptions. Escort deliveries to the loading dock only. Log every entry in the lobby register before heading up. The east stairwell stays locked overnight; use the service corridor by the mailroom. To open the corridor door, enter the code below at the keypad.

door code, tahop-fahap: bdg-JZCXMY-37375484

Subject: Second-Source Search — Status

Exec team: we've shortlisted two alternates for the Vellick sensor line — Dunmoor Components and Tarsel Works. Samples arrive next week. Pricing is within 5% of current. Sales leads, hold customer commitments on lead times until qualification completes.

The confidential reasoning behind this move is appended below.

confidential, tadug-yafog: Lamathox Systems plans to lower the Joreth list price by 4 percent in September.